250+ interactive mathematical visualizations, in a single self-contained web page.
Live demo — open on any device
No install, no build step, no backend. Open the link on your laptop or your phone and every visualization runs live in the browser, driven entirely by Canvas + vanilla JavaScript.
Each entry is a real, interactive simulation — not a static image. Drag sliders, change parameters, watch the picture redraw in real time. Every one ships with the equation behind it and a short write-up of why it's surprising.
